Output 923585ea6b04c7132e833eccd1917605eb1031d4e1c26b2e486e513681608350:0

value
6539900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06a8197110ed7afe0501e8c4b722f32a32ce097a OP_EQUAL
address
M8WMfL9bMRG6zBwUefdNj9Hw9oebK2H86P
transaction
923585ea6b04c7132e833eccd1917605eb1031d4e1c26b2e486e513681608350
spent
true